py27-characteristic-14.3.0

Basic Info:

Python attributes without boilerplate

homepage: https://characteristic.readthedocs.io/
license: mit
install size: 174716
build date: 2019-01-30 19:17:32 +0000
package file: py27-characteristic-14.3.0.tgz
package size: 34818

Description:

characteristic is an MIT-licensed Python package with class decorators
that ease the chores of implementing the most common attribute-related
object protocols.

You just specify the attributes to work with and characteristic
gives you any or all of:

* a nice human-readable __repr__,
* a complete set of comparison methods,
* immutability for attributes,
* and a kwargs-based initializer (that cooperates with your existing
one and optionally even checks the types of the arguments)

without writing dull boilerplate code again and again.

This gives you the power to use actual classes with actual types
in your code instead of confusing tuples or confusingly behaving
namedtuples.

So put down that type-less data structures and welcome some class
into your life!

Homepage:
https://characteristic.readthedocs.io/

Provides:

Requires:

Depends:

py27-setuptools>=0.8
python>=2.7.1nb2<2.8

Package List

File NameDateSize
lib/python2.7/site-packages/characteristic-14.3.0-py2.7.egg-info/PKG-INFO2019-01-30 12:174027 bytes
lib/python2.7/site-packages/characteristic-14.3.0-py2.7.egg-info/SOURCES.txt2019-01-30 12:17468 bytes
lib/python2.7/site-packages/characteristic-14.3.0-py2.7.egg-info/dependency_links.txt2019-01-30 12:171 bytes
lib/python2.7/site-packages/characteristic-14.3.0-py2.7.egg-info/top_level.txt2019-01-30 12:1735 bytes
lib/python2.7/site-packages/characteristic.py2014-12-19 06:4621525 bytes
lib/python2.7/site-packages/characteristic.pyc2019-01-30 12:1722225 bytes
lib/python2.7/site-packages/characteristic.pyo2019-01-30 12:1722225 bytes
lib/python2.7/site-packages/test_characteristic.py2014-12-19 06:3323954 bytes
lib/python2.7/site-packages/test_characteristic.pyc2019-01-30 12:1742385 bytes
lib/python2.7/site-packages/test_characteristic.pyo2019-01-30 12:1737871 bytes